... alright...
Sure, MF's hard, but he's semi-predictable and gives off mostly clear signals in the first 3/4 of the fight. All in all, the fight lasts a few minutes. No Heart took an hour, and I was moving the entire time. There was no "Oh, he's going to use this move next", it was "fljsbflsf GTFO of the way!" the whole time. I enjoyed No Heart because it was constant engagement, something that I don't find common in boss fights these days. In fact, I noticed at the last second that my battery was almost dead. That's how much it pulled me in.
And that's why No Heart's my favorite boss. It required my full effort, both physically, mentally, and electrically.
